Assessing Your Candidateship for Vision Adjustment Surgical Treatment



Have you thought of the variables to consider in analyzing your candidacy for vision correction surgical procedure?

Deciding to undertake simply click the up coming post is a huge action, and there are a number of important aspects to take into consideration.

Primarily, your general eye wellness need to be examined by an experienced ophthalmologist. They'll assess your prescription stability and the health and wellness of your cornea to establish if you're a suitable candidate.

Additionally, your age and way of living must be thought about. Some procedures, like LASIK, are preferable for younger clients with moderate to moderate prescriptions, while others, like lens implantation, might be better for individuals with higher prescriptions or age-related vision changes.

Ultimately, it's vital to have realistic expectations and understand the potential threats and benefits of the procedure.
